Smart Shopping Strategies
One of the smartest ways to score an affordable wedding dress is by shopping sample sales and off-the-rack deals. Many bridal boutiques sell their sample dresses (those used for fittings) at 50-70% off retail prices. These gowns are typically in excellent condition, having only been tried on in the store. You might even find last-season designer dresses from prestigious labels at unbelievable discounts. The key is calling local shops to ask about their sample sale schedules and inventory.
2025's Budget-Friendly Trends
Simpler designs naturally cost less, and 2025's trends actually favor many budget-friendly options. Minimalist wedding dresses with clean lines and luxurious fabrics like crepe or mikado are both stylish and affordable. Sheath and A-line silhouettes require less fabric and structural elements than elaborate ballgowns, keeping costs down while still offering elegant style. Many brides are discovering that these streamlined designs often photograph even better than heavily embellished gowns.
Top Places to Find Affordable Wedding Dresses
For online shoppers, several retailers specialize in affordable wedding dresses under $1,000. Azazie offers made-to-order gowns between $500-$900 with custom sizing options, eliminating expensive alterations. Lulus features trendy styles from $200-$600, perfect for fashion-forward brides. Even David's Bridal has an extensive under-$1,000 collection, with frequent sales bringing prices even lower. The convenience of online shopping allows you to compare hundreds of options without leaving home.

Pre-Loved and Secondhand Options
Pre-loved wedding dresses present another excellent avenue for savings. Websites like Stillwhite and Nearly Newlywed connect brides selling their lightly worn dresses with new brides looking for deals. You can often find dresses at 50-80% off original retail prices. When shopping secondhand, always ask for detailed photos of any wear and tear, and request the original receipt to verify authenticity.

Maximizing Your Budget
To maximize your budget, consider skipping expensive customizations like added lace or beadwork. Many beautiful dresses look stunning in their original designs. Shopping during sales events like Black Friday or end-of-season clearances can yield incredible discounts. Another smart strategy is considering separates - a skirt and top combination often costs less than a one-piece gown while offering versatile styling options.
Styling on a Budget
Even with an affordable wedding dress, strategic styling can create a luxe look. A statement belt or dramatic veil can elevate a simple gown. Proper alterations make any dress look custom-made - focus on perfecting the fit at the waist and hemline. Your bouquet choice also impacts the overall effect; a cascading floral arrangement adds elegance to a minimalist dress.
